Fun lift-the-flaps foster the imagination and reveal colorful new images


Images of different fruits transform into animals with lift-the-flaps in this interactive book. Readers of all ages will delight in trying to guess the next surprise. A pineapple becomes a yellow armadillo; a red apple turns into the face of a monkey. What will become of an orange, a banana, grapes, and more? The irresistible guessing game encourages children to imagine the possibilities.
"By lifting flaps, youngsters can transform fruit into animals. Yonezu’s style, utilizing a thick, clumpy black line and bold, flat colors, is eye-catchingly simple without ever becoming boring. Surprising and engaging."—Kirkus Reviews

"Featuring simple illustrations with bold, saturated colors outlined in thick black lines, these winsome volumes invite toddlers to lift the flap to reveal that the attractive-looking foods on display are in fact animals. Fun and creative."—School Library Journal
Yusuke Yonezu was born in Tokyo, Japan, where he still lives with his wife and children. As a child he loved to draw and make toys out of paper and boxes. He went on to study design and became the creator of many board books, puzzles, and toys beloved by children and their caregivers around the world. View titles by Yusuke Yonezu
